You also could make a bioship with accessspace, if you go for the
assumption that bioships need humans as "crocodile birds".
It might make sense to build some components of a bioship from metal. You
get a bioship with cyberware then.
SF stories occasionally have aliens, where the line between being
components of one being, and a groups of beings living in a complex
symbiosis gets blurred. Bioships built that way, would be at least
somewhat modular, and are safer from damage spilling from one component to
the next.
